Your Data Is Worthless
If You Can’t Use It
Mai-Lan Tomsen Bukovec, vice-president of foundational data services at AWS, took the stage with AWS distinguished engineer Andy Warfield to chat about storage innovations and how customers are making use of large-scale data lakes and high-performance data.
“I have worked in AWS for 12 years, and I couldn’t think of a more exciting time for a data-driven business,” said Bukovec,
a former Microsoft team leader and U.S. Peace Corps volunteer. “IDC forecasts that just in 2022, the amount of data created and replicated all over the world is 101 zettabytes.” A zettabyte is 1 trillion gigabytes, she explained.
“The data is coming from an incredible variety of sources, ranging from applications to phones to cars, and it powers the applications that we build in every industry all over the world. I think of it as the new normal,” she said.
Business leaders need trustworthy services that can also help them use data with speed, scale
and agility.
